The material growth, preparation of Schottky junction and activation technique for a field-assisted heterojunction semiconductor photocathode with 1.25μm threshold have been studied in detail. The photocathode with higher response in the wavelength range from 0.9μm to 1.25μm has been achieved. Utilizing the LPE technology, the material of heterojunction field-assisted photocathode has been obtained with the mismatch rate better than -1.23×10-4. The optimum value (n=1.08) of ideal factor for the field-assisted Schottky junction has been obtained in the UHV system. At 4.5 V bias, the quantum efficiency is 2.5×10-4 at 1.25 μm, which is nearly 2 orders of magnitude higher than that of Ag-O-Cs (S-1) photocathodes at same wavelength.

    A KrF resonator-amplifier excimer laser system using for submicro fine processing was reported. This system can operate in the situation of 200 Hz repetition rate with output power of 24.4 W and spectrum of 2.3×10-3 nm. Its spectrum drift is less 5×10-4 nm during operation.

    The investigation of noncollinear type II phase-matching parametric upconver-sion of CO2 laser in a silver thiogallate (AgGaS2) crystal pumped with a Q-switohed Nd:YAG laser is reported. The computer calculation of optimizing noncollinear angle at which the phase mismatch ΔK is equal to zero is performed. The conversion efficiency was found to be 16.1% for the pump laser of 6MW/cm2 power density in a crystal of 4.7mm long, and the converted radiation was first detected by using a Si avalanche photodiode SPD-052.

    The spatial propagation properties of output annular laser beam from an unstable resonator are studied based on Fresnel diffraction integral. According to the position of extreme value point of laser intensity on the axis, the formula used to divide the propagation space of output beam from unstable resonator into near field, middle field and far field is derived. The numerical calculation shows the variation process of output laser beam of unstable resonator from annular pattern on near field, with gradual transition of laser energy in the annular region to the beam's center, to Airy disk pattern on far field. The experimental results obtained in TEA pulsed CO2 laser with unstable resonator are in good agreement with theoretical results.

    The 34 layers tapCuPo, the copper tera-4- ( 2.4-ditert-ampylphenoxy) phtha-locyanine, were deposited by the LB technique on the optical glass waveguide of K+ ion-exchange, and a four-layer dielectric waveguide with LB films cladding is formed. The 532 nm line from a YAG laser is used as a light source. The input light with pulse width of 250 ps is coupled into the optical waveguide by a glass prism, and then is passed through the regiod coated with the LB films. In the experiment,a fast optical bistability with the switching off time to 24 ps has been demonstrated.

    In this letter we report the nonlinear property of pyrylium-doped superpolymer studied by degenerate four-wave mixing (DFWM). The nonlinear susceptibility x(3) of pyrylium-doped polymer is 3×10-10 e.s.u.. The time resolution curve formed by the decay of phase conjugate reflection as a function of the delay of the backward pump pulse in the counterpropagating DFWM scheme was observed, and the relaxation time is 30 ps. The electronic and brientational mechanisms are discussed.

    The spetrum for the 6snp Rydberg series of Yb Atom were obtained by using three-step laser excitation. The laser for the first and second step of exoi-tation were oppositely circularly polarized and for the third step was linearly polarized. By the selection rules of the magnetic quantum number m the J value for each spectral line was determined. Some new levels belonging to the 6sns 3Si series (n=26-31) were detected.

    This pepar studied pyruvate dehydrogenase using dynamic light scattering (DLS) with photon counting technique and obtained some data on its microstructure. Radii of PDO and E2-X-K are measured. It is found that at lower concentration the aggregation can be neglected, the size distribution is monodispersion, and the linewidths of DLS spectra of PDC and E2-X-K are proportional to q2 and q3 respectively. But at higher concentration the size distribution is polydispers ion and Γ is proportional to qα, where a is fractional.

    This paper describes the optical Fabry-Perrot cavity made of polymer DR/ PMMA thin film. Prom the observation of the transmission variation with the applied electric field, we can identify the nonlinear optical parameters. For DR/ PMMA we have obtained the third order nonlinear susceptibility x(3)(-ω;ω,0,0)=(5.3-i 6.0) ×10-11e.s.u. and quadratic eleotro-optio coefficient R=-(8.5-i 9.7)×10-19 m2/V2 at 575 nm and room temperature.
